The board approved a package of election-related items for the May 3, 2025 joint election, including a resolution to conduct a joint election with Lubbock County, appointments of election officers and adoption of Hart Verity election equipment; the motion passed 7-0.

The Lubbock ISD Board of Trustees approved a package of 2025 general election items to support a joint May 3, 2025 election, including a joint election resolution, contracts with Lubbock County, and appointments of election officers and early-voting personnel. The board moved and approved the list of items as presented; the meeting record shows the motion carried 7-0.
